Carrais Posted April 1, 2012 Share Posted April 1, 2012 So I roll with the Eliminator set as an Assault Vanguard at present. I've remodded some with crit/surge or power/surge and currently have about 100 points of accuracy. However, I've noticed that HiB will sometimes miss, which is usually devastating when trying to burst down a healer. So, how much Accuracy should I be shooting for? GitRDone Posted April 2, 2012 Share Posted April 2, 2012 (edited) Anywhere between 0-100 points of accuracy will do the trick. Preferably closer to 0. Accuracy only affects your RANGED type attacks, and keep in mind that only 15%-30% of your attacks will be High Impact Shot. Having an extra 5% on 15% of your attacks amounts to less than 1% DPS increase, as opposed to having an extra 100 aim which applies 20 extra damage on all your attacks. Edit: Dealing with healers, you may want to consider an alternate method: Ion Pulse, Riot strike, Stockstrike, Cryo Grenade, High Impact Shot, Riot Strike, Hammer Shot, Neural Surge, Stock Strike, Riot Strike, High Impact Shot.
